Earn Your SSI Open Water Diver Certification in Lagos, Portugal

Located on Portugal's sunny Algarve coast, Lagos is a vibrant seaside town renowned for its dramatic cliffs and clear Atlantic waters. Here, the SSI Open Water Diver program offers an unmatched introduction to scuba diving, perfect for those ready to explore beneath the waves. This globally recognized certification course includes four dives over four days, combining classroom instruction, confined water pool training, and open water dives that plunge you into the region’s spectacular marine life and rugged underwater rock formations.

What makes diving in Lagos unique is the striking underwater terrain sculpted by volcanic arches and caves along the coastline. The area’s marine ecosystem features colorful fish species like Mediterranean damselfish and octopuses that habitually hide in crevices, offering divers a vivid, close-up experience. The Atlantic currents here bring nutrient-rich waters that sustain thriving aquatic flora, including swaying sea fans and bright green algae mats.

The training itself is thorough but welcoming, accommodating beginners with no previous experience. SSI’s methodical approach ensures you build confidence and competency as you master key skills in a controlled pool before setting out to the more demanding open water environments. Plus, the small class sizes mean personalized attention and a supportive vibe.

Lagos not only boasts excellent dive sites but also charming cobbled streets and vibrant seafood eateries, making it a perfect base for your underwater adventure. Beyond certification, diving here connects you with a rich cultural heritage, where fishing traditions and seafaring history shape the local identity. Lagos was historically a launching point for Portuguese explorers, adding a layer of intrigue to your aquatic exploration.

Safety and sustainability are prioritized throughout the program. Dive operators here adhere to strict environmental guidelines to protect the fragile marine habitats from overuse, supporting conservation efforts in one of Europe’s most treasured coastal regions.

For photography, early morning dives provide the best lighting to capture underwater textures and wildlife in vivid colors. Noteworthy photo spots include iconic caves and the rocky reefs teeming with diverse fauna. You’ll find the crisp waters of Lagos alongside historic shorelines a perfect contrast for above-water shots.

Whether you’re seeking your first certification or aiming to refresh your scuba skills, the SSI Open Water Diver experience in Lagos blends expert instruction, stunning ocean scenery, and cultural richness into a memorable adventure that sets the foundation for a lifetime of underwater exploration.

About We Dive

We Dive is a dive operator based in Lagos, Faro, offering guided scuba dives, boat trips, and SSI and PADI training. Operating from Lagos on the Algarve coast, We Dive runs experience-focused activities including Bubble Maker, Try Scuba Diving (pool + sea), single and double guided dives, and a 2-hour boat trip with snorkeling equipment that visits the rock formations of Ponta da Piedade.

The center delivers certification courses such as SSI Open Water Diver, SSI Scuba Diver, SSI Advanced Adventurer, SSI Science of Diving, SSI Wreck Diving, SSI Dry Suit Diving, SSI Diver Stress & Rescue, SSI Deep Diving (3 and 4 dives), SSI Perfect Buoyancy, SSI Boat Diving, SSI React Right, SSI Search & Recovery, SSI Nitrox Diving, SSI Underwater Navigation, SSI Photo & Video, and PADI Advanced Open Water Diver. Several programs include professional supervision, gear rental, insurance, and digital study materials where specified.

Practical dives are offered in small groups with flexibility on dive sites according to weather and sea conditions; guided dives include depths described for specific experiences (for example, single dives commonly range from 5 to 18 meters, and wreck specialties can reach depths up to 30 meters). The center emphasizes safety through trained instructors and structured courses from recognised agencies. For non-certified visitors We Dive provides introductory sessions like Bubble Maker and Try Scuba Diving with brief pool lessons followed by sheltered-bay sea dives. Clear booking information, course prerequisites, and up-to-date safety protocols are available directly from the operator. Bookings are available online.
